JAVA访问firebird数据库之Jaybird
关于Jaybird-2.1.6JDK_1.5的使用方法如下:
首先:安装Jaybird
第一步:将根目录下的
jaybird21.dll,
GDS32.DLL,
icudt30.dll,
icuuc30.dll,
fbembed.dll,
icuin30.dll
fbclient.dll(对于非嵌入式型FB数据库的连接为必须)
这几个文件放在system32下面
第二步:把 jaybird 里的三个jar文件放在应用程序的相应的classpath里,然后
第三步:
加载实例:
关于实例文件DataSourceExample.java的使用
如果是连接非嵌入式FB数据库,则将
dataSource.setType("EMBEDDED");改为dataSource.setType("LOCAL")
【位于DataSourceExample.java源文件中,如果不修改,则显示不能连接成功】
其次:
java中连接文件的写法:
driverName = "org.firebirdsql.jdbc.FBDriver";
URLName = "jdbc:firebirdsql:embedded:E:/Project/test.fdb";
user = "sysdba";
password = "masterkey";
今日:研究FB数据库许久,参考了网友的资料,不胜感激!于MyEclipse6.0.1上调试成功,在此同大家分享。
DLL资源:见我的资源!!!
分享到:
相关推荐
关于Jaybird-2.1.6JDK_1.5的使用方法如下: 首先:安装Jaybird 第一步:将根目录下的 jaybird21.dll, GDS32.DLL, icudt30.dll, icuuc30.dll, fbembed.dll, icuin30.dll fbclient.dll(对于非嵌入式型FB...
Jaybird是Firebird官方推荐的Java JDBC驱动,它实现了Java Database Connectivity (JDBC) API,允许Java程序与Firebird数据库进行交互。在你提供的压缩包中,有三个关键的jar文件: 1. **jaybird-full-2.1.6.jar**...
JayBird-Java连接FireBird数据库包,Firebird JCA/JDBC Driver。 常见异常代码:No connection character set specified (property lc_ctype, encoding, charSet
在本例中,我们关注的是如何使用Java通过Jaybird驱动读取Firebird数据库,以及涉及的三个jar包——jaybird-2.1.6.jar、jaybird-full-2.1.6.jar和jaybird-pool-2.1.6.jar。 1. **Jaybird驱动**:Jaybird是Java对...
正确配置和使用这些驱动,可以让你的Java应用充分利用Firebird数据库的强大功能,并实现高效的数据访问。在实际开发中,一定要注意版本兼容性,确保驱动版本与数据库服务器版本相匹配,以避免可能出现的问题。
firebird数据库相关链接库(dll)文件 包括: jaybird21.dll icuuc30.dll fbembed.dll GDS32.DLL icudt30.dll icuin30.dll 放到system32下即可
在Java中连接Firebird数据库,我们需要Firebird的JDBC驱动,也就是Jaybird。从描述和标签中可以看出,提供的压缩包中包含了Jaybird 2.2.0版本的驱动。Jaybird是Firebird官方推荐的Java JDBC驱动,它实现了JDBC 4.0...
《Java 8与JDBC 4.2:Jaybird 2.2.11与Firebird数据库的深度解析》 Jaybird 2.2.11是一款专为Java 8和JDBC 4.2设计的Firebird数据库连接驱动,它提供了一种高效且可靠的途径,使Java应用程序能够无缝地与Firebird...
《Jaybird 2.2.11:Java 7与JDBC 4.2的Firebird数据库连接神器》 在Java开发中,数据库连接扮演着至关重要的角色,尤其是在使用Firebird这种高性能的关系型数据库时。Jaybird是专为Java设计的Firebird数据库JDBC...
- Firebird提供多种语言的API接口,如InterBase API、Firebird API (IBPP) 和 Jaybird(Java)等,方便开发者进行数据库编程。 8. **社区和资源**: - Firebird拥有活跃的开源社区,提供丰富的文档、教程和论坛...
在Java开发环境中,为了连接Firebird数据库,就需要使用Firebird JDBC驱动,也就是Jaybird。"firebird jdbc driver"标题指出我们要讨论的是针对Java应用程序与Firebird数据库交互的驱动程序。 "firebird java jdbc ...
火鸟数据库-jdk8-驱动的核心组件是Jaybird,这是一个由Firebird官方维护的Java JDBC驱动。在提供的压缩包中,我们看到了多个与Jaybird相关的文件: 1. `release_notes.html`:这是发布说明文件,通常包含了驱动的...
在Java环境下,通常会使用Jaybird作为JDBC驱动来连接FireBird数据库。安装并配置Jaybird后,可以通过Java的`java.sql.DriverManager`类来建立与FireBird服务器的连接。 ```java Class.forName("org.firebirdsql....
开发人员可以使用各种编程语言(如Delphi、C++Builder、Java、Python等)通过API(如IBObjects、Jaybird、JDBC等)与Firebird进行交互。此外,还有图形化管理工具如FlameRobin,便于数据库的管理和维护。 4. **...
Firebird 数据库复制工具基于java。 主从同构基于触发器的复制工具。 支持同步和异步复制。 包括用于集中数据库辅助实施的新图形界面。 多平台,用 java 1.8 语言编写。 现在支持 Firebird 3.0、Jaybird 3.0.6。
Jaybird Jaybird是用于连接到Firebird数据库服务器的JDBC驱动程序套件。报告错误或改进有关安全漏洞,请参阅“ 。有关错误或改进,请转到我们的。资源执照Jaybird已获得LGPL 2.1或更高版本的许可,而扩展接口已获得...
Jaybird是Firebird SQL数据库的Java JDBC驱动,它允许Java应用程序与Firebird数据库进行交互。Jaybird驱动程序提供了一种标准的Java接口,使得开发人员可以利用JDBC API来操作Firebird数据库,而无需了解数据库底层...
在上述依赖中,`spring-boot-starter-data-jpa`提供了对JPA(Java Persistence API)的支持,而`jaybird-jdbc`是Firebird的Java JDBC驱动,用于连接Firebird数据库。 接下来,我们需要配置Spring Boot以连接...
Jaybird是Java平台上的一个开源驱动,专门用于连接到Firebird数据库系统。它遵循JDBC(Java Database Connectivity)标准,使得Java应用程序能够无缝地与Firebird数据库进行通信。Jaybird驱动程序提供了一种高效、...
FireBird JDBC数据库连接驱动包,java,亲测可用。版本3.0.5